Output 93b853653663e909cdfbe9e77c9c66dc234710f995d0eb70c56a4f3b5941bc56:8

value
5086478550
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 663843ab16b26db31466016ce8b0365a71158ef5 OP_EQUALVERIFY OP_CHECKSIG
address
LUYSb6PynxwvEjzLLifYGs15Rp4nNEPX5z
transaction
93b853653663e909cdfbe9e77c9c66dc234710f995d0eb70c56a4f3b5941bc56
spent
true